Enhancement: Increase time for a client to search for an available connection from 1.5 seconds to 3 seconds. This will help when clients are changing channels and release the old connection AFTER attempting to start the new connection. Closes #503
Bug Fix: Fix a bug where searching for an available stream could clear out stream locks for streams that it never acquired a lock for.
